What the report says

Uganda’s Office of the President has recalled Bukwo District Resident District Commissioner George Owany with immediate effect, according to The Independent in Kampala, as allegations of corruption and mismanagement around district projects come under review. The report says the recall followed a directive for Owany to report to the President’s Office on August 28, 2026, and to hand over day-to-day duties to the deputy RDC while consultations continue.

The key allegation cited in the article is that Owany was suspected of soliciting 109 million Ugandan shillings from SACCO leaders in Bukwo District, with each of 109 SACCOs allegedly asked to contribute one million shillings. The minister of local government, Balaam Barugahara Ateenyi, ordered Owany’s arrest and transfer to the State House Anti-Corruption Unit for investigation, according to the report. Barugahara also directed him to surrender his phone to assist investigators.

The story places the case in the wider context of anti-corruption enforcement in local government. It also notes separate concerns about the way some government projects in Bukwo were commissioned and whether proper district approvals and procurement steps were followed. Those claims, the article says, have not been independently established and remain under investigation. The developments have drawn renewed scrutiny to how district officials oversee public funds and projects in Uganda’s local administration system.
